Washington DC – The National Black Church Initiative (NBCI) a faith-based coalition of 34,000 churches comprised of 15 denominations and 15.7 million African American churchgoers calls on Christians everywhere to pray for the soul of America. The church is saddened and angered that juries across the U.S. refuse to convict privileged majorities at the expense of unarmed and defenseless young back men. Black mothers and fathers must know that their black boys will be protected by the law and not be a victim of the law. How much pain must a race of people continue to take?
A favorable verdict for Mr. Dunn undoubtedly ignites deeper racial divides and instigates conflict. The church cannot continue to tell black mothers that they must sacrifice their boys to the racist fears of white males and to a law deeply rooted in evil. The American Legislative Exchange Council, ALEC, is the true guilty party in this case. They have created justifiable homicide, rooted in racial discrimination. ALEC must be held responsible for every single death around the country.
Rev. Anthony Evans NBCI President, says, “All my life I’ve tried to create a symphony of brotherhood, and now I must spend the rest of my life fighting against organizations such as ALEC who do nothing but legislate for the privileged at the expense of the poor and underserved. Do not expect the church to utilize it enormous moral power to stop non-violent protests. This verdict undermines the principle of God and our fragile democracy and should be considered with the utmost severity. We Jordan Davis’ death will not be in vain, and NBCI will continue to fight for justice when it comes down to stand your ground. Legal homicide must stop – in the name of God. ”
About NBCI
The National Black Church Initiative (NBCI) is a coalition of 34,000 churches working to eradicate racial disparities in healthcare, technology, education, housing, and the environment. NBCI’s mission is to provide critical wellness information to all of its members, congregants, churches and the public. NBCI offers faith-based, out-of-the box and cutting edge solutions to stubborn economic and social issues.
